    Ok guys and gals, The last Merc in Mick's post 6547 and on page 217, post 6501. ..... is that Bob Johnson's SO FINE 50 Merc that graced the cover of Classic & Custom August 1981 and Custom Rodder January 1983? So similar. I can see it has hood louvers and not-rounded hood corners. The post on page 217 shows a peep mirror. In the above pic with the door open, it has a side mirror in the normal position. SO FINE had a chrome pointy side mirror, like a Mustang/Cougar when featured on Classic & Custom magazine.

"He got started by chopping the top 3-1/2 inches in the front to a graduated 4 inches at the rear and followed by laying back the windshield to achieve the right flow as well as pie-cutting the trunklid to complete the look. From there he sectioned the body 0 inches up front tapering to 2-1/2 inches at the back and continued by channeling the body 3-1/2 inches in front tapering to 2 inches out back."

    Here is a pic of Bob`s car taken in about 81. His 50 Merc won the King Of Merc`s in 79 in Kansas City Merc Duce Reunion.
    Scan0091.jpg Notic the dual frenched Antennas. The last Bob knew, it was in Florida. I think that's right. Bob did not add the flames.
